
Here in the Northwest, our roofs take a beating from rain, high winds, snow, salt (on the coast), ice and large temperature swings. These tough conditions lead to a constant battle against moss, granular loss, tree droppings, fading, creaking, lifting, rust, ice damage and lost shingles. Composite, cedar, steel and even tile roofs struggle to maintain a good appearance and long life under such conditions.

There are a few reasons why homeowners may be looking for a new roof. A major accident, such as a tree getting blown over on to the top of the house. Roofing has a recommended lifespan - asphalt shingle roofs are usually rated for 25 years for example. Depending on the age of your roof, it may be time for something new.

Once reserved for barn roofs, sheds, and shacks, metal roofing is becoming more common for residential applications. This isn't corrugated metal roofing, either - there are several types of metal roofs today. A variety of colors allow homeowners to give their homes an immediate facelift. Aluminum roofs are nearly maintenance-free and built to last a century.
